She was born on
July 15th 1919
08:00 hrs BST
Dublin, Ireland.
Asc: 19 Leo 23'
Moon: 16 Aqua 08'
Her writing talent is admirably shown, I think, by Mercury's conjunction
with the Leo Ascendant, it being ruler of her 2nd, how we earn our
money. In a thread on aam a while back we discussed signs of writing
talent in a chart, and I suggested that Mercury in aspect to the Moon
and Neptune, involving the 12th house, would give just the right amount
of wit and imagination to make a good writer.
Here we see Mercury opposed to the Moon, and widely conjunct Neptune,
which is in the 12th, ruled by the Moon.
Also, check out the 5th house, it being the house of creativity. Sag' on
the cusp, with ruler Jupiter exalted in Cancer and conjunct the Sun, on
cusp 12. This to my mind, is an indication of a prodigious talent, and a
very healthy ego, to boot!
What then, of the Alzheimer's, which finally destroyed her mind?
The 6th is the house of sickness, and here Saturn rules it from the
first house, and is in detriment. He is also conjunct her Mercury, and
Lilly says in C.A., page 78, that Mercury diseases include:
"...lethargies or giddinesse in the head, Madnesse, either Lightness,
or any disease of the Braine....all defects of the Memory, all Evils in
the Fancy and Intellectuall parts."
I suppose in Lilly's day, this would be one way of describing
Alzheimer's Disease.
As an aside, and as a way of bowing to the midpoint school of thought,
that Mercury also sits on the SA/NE midpoint.
( ME = SA/NE ), and Ebertin describes SA/NE as the "sickness axis".
